Paperback. Condition: New. Print on Demand. This book is a fascinating travelogue of England in the mid-1800s by the celebrated American abolitionist, orator, and clergyman Henry Ward Beecher. The first half of the book focuses on the author's rambles through the English countryside, offering evocative descriptions of places like Kenilworth Castle and Stratford-upon-Avon, the birthplace of William Shakespeare. His observations on the beauty of the English landscape and architecture reveal the author's keen eye for detail and his appreciation for the historical significance of his surroundings. In the second half, Beecher presents his thoughts on a wide range of topics, including religion, education, and social reform, providing insights into the intellectual and cultural climate of the time. Ultimately, this book combines vivid travel writing with philosophical reflections, capturing the spirit of England in transition and affirming the author's belief in the power of nature and the importance of human progress. Octavo, brown blind-stamped cloth (hardcover), gilt letters, 359 pp. Very Good, with light rubbing to covers and bumped corners. Contents: Letters from Europe -- Ruins of Kenilworth - Warwick Castle; A Sabbath at Stratford-on-Avon; Oxford; The Louvre - Luxembourg Gallers; The Louvre; London National Gallery; Experiences of Nature: A Discourse of FLowers; Death in the Country; Island vs. Seashore; New England Graveyards; Towns and Trees; The First Breath in the Country; Trouting; A Ride; The Mountain Stream; A Country Ride; Farewell to the Country; School Reminiscence; The Value of Birds; Rough Picture from Life; A Ride to Fort Hamilton; Sights from My Window; The Death of Our Almanac; Fog in the Harbor; The Morals of Fishing; The Wanderings of a Star; Book-Stores, Books; Gone to the Country; Dream-Culture; A Walk Among Trees; Building a House; Christian Liberty in the Use of the Beautiful; Nature a Minister of Happiness; Springs and Solitudes; Mid-October Days; A Moist Letter; Frost in the Window; Snow-Storm Traveling.
